summaryrefslogtreecommitdiff
path: root/battle-e/battletrainer.asm
diff options
context:
space:
mode:
authorHáčky <hatschky@gmail.com>2014-11-27 07:15:45 +0000
committerHáčky <hatschky@gmail.com>2014-11-27 07:15:45 +0000
commit319ed6d0e0266f5f6174a5acd929914db8cfae1d (patch)
tree76408d9cadcbed1e702efa8c44f4cf5e364b0a4d /battle-e/battletrainer.asm
parent17853b802692237d98f96d1a80caf2019f71753e (diff)
Code cleanup; preparation for Japanese Battle eHEADmaster
Diffstat (limited to 'battle-e/battletrainer.asm')
-rw-r--r--battle-e/battletrainer.asm27
1 files changed, 9 insertions, 18 deletions
diff --git a/battle-e/battletrainer.asm b/battle-e/battletrainer.asm
index 4516fb5..421ddd3 100644
--- a/battle-e/battletrainer.asm
+++ b/battle-e/battletrainer.asm
@@ -1,6 +1,3 @@
-INCLUDE "../macros.asm"
-
-BattleTrainer: MACRO
SECTION "battletrainer",ROM0[$100]
jp Start
db $00
@@ -24,21 +21,16 @@ BackdropTilemap: ; A7C
INCBIN "sprites/battletrainer.tilemap"
Prologue: ; 0DFC
- Insert_Prologue $12345678, "カ。ドE@", REGION_EN ; corrupted カードe “Card e”
+ INCBIN "prologue-{REGION_NAME}.bin"
DataPacket: ; 0E38
- Insert_Header REGION_EN
- db BATTLE_TRAINER
- GBAPTR DataPacket, TrainerData ; $02000018
- dw $0002
-TrainerData: ; 0E50
- INCBIN \1
+ INCBIN "trainers/{TRAINER}-{REGION_NAME}.mev"
REPT 44
db 0 ; pads the data to 256 bytes
ENDR
TrainerSprite: ; 0F38
- INCBIN \2
+ INCBIN "sprites/trainers/{CLASS}.4bpp"
TrainerSpriteData: ; 1738
dw TrainerSprite
dw TrainerPalette
@@ -196,10 +188,9 @@ INCLUDE "../common/transfer_data.asm"
INCLUDE "../common/wrap_up.asm"
INCLUDE "../common/word_shift_right.asm"
-SomeVar1: ds 1 ; 1B9F
-SomeVar2: ds 2 ; 1BA0
-RegionHandlePtr: ds 1 ; 1BA2
-LeftDoorSpriteHandle: ds 2 ; 1BA3
-RightDoorSpriteHandle: ds 2 ; 1BA5
-TrainerSpriteHandle: ds 2 ; 1BA7
-ENDM \ No newline at end of file
+SomeVar1: EOF ; 1B9F
+SomeVar2: dw 0 ; 1BA0
+RegionHandlePtr: db 0 ; 1BA2
+LeftDoorSpriteHandle: dw 0 ; 1BA3
+RightDoorSpriteHandle: dw 0 ; 1BA5
+TrainerSpriteHandle: dw 0 ; 1BA7 \ No newline at end of file